    M820 Bafang - LIGHTCARBON LCE930 Frame (lightweight)

    I had an issue with the black plug next to the yellow plug on the motor. if its not pushed in hard enough, nothing turns on. I have to use pliers for a little more leverage to get it to seat fully in the plug. make sure to test it before tightening the 3 mounting bolts.

    LCE930 headset

    Here is the solution for those that are fed up with their LCE930 headset. ACROS ICR headset-3 part numbers 1. 24.52.113-OD56-AM (is52 cover) 2. 51.02.002R1-AM (crown race) 3. 56.52.920R1 (bearings/integrated cable routing)
